Anyway, about the original post... I'm not the biggest fan.

Quote

Surfboard

Driftwood Surfboard

Sea Queen's Surfboard

Having three different surfboards where the only differences between them are the stats is just unnecessary imo. I've heard suggestions for stuff like a "living log surfboard" since early on in SW's life, and I've never been a fan.
In DS, Walani's one type of surfboard is very useful in the early game, then continues being pretty useful in certain situations in the late game, especially if you're lazy like me and don't want to make boats for Hamlet's lilyponds. I'd argue that Walani's surfboard, if ported over exactly the same as it is in DS, would be incredibly useful just by letting you find the lunar islands and mine salt formations without worrying about boats. Splitting it up into three surfboards just feels like change for the sake of change, rather than change with a good reason behind it.

Quote

*Is a pretty chill gal.

Sanity auras, both positive and negative, are only 50% effective to Walani.
Instant sanity modifiers (ex: green caps, cooked cacti) are 66% effective.

Making the sanity aura modifier more extreme is a great idea, since it's so small it's not even noticeable in DS, but it should stay just for sanity auras. All this sanity item change would do is lead to annoyance, because Walani would have to eat more of the same food to get her sanity up or down.

Quote

* Is lazy when sane.

When above 80% sanity, Walani slows down in multiple aspects.
-95% movement speed.
-20% longer swing speed.
-100% longer crafting / picking time.
-Hunger drain is reduced to 90%.

When below 80% sanity, Walani's hunger drain increases to 120%.

And this... this would be a good way to make me not enjoy Walani at all. The absolute worst downside any character can have in DS/T is doing things slower, because all it does is make things more tedious. This would add difficultly in very very specific scenarios, like being chased by a hostile mob while it's turning to night and you're trying to collect the resources for a torch, the rest of the time it would simply add tedium and annoyance.

Whenever coming up with a DS/T character, you should always think: would this be fun? Particularly, would this downside be interesting and fun to work around, or just annoying? These downsides don't sound fun to work around, in my opinion, they just sound annoying.
